can diet cause hair loss Can diet cause hair loss and what can you do about it?
Maintaining a healthy diet is essential for overall well-being, but did you know that it can also impact your hair health? While genetics and other factors can contribute to hair loss, diet can play a significant role as well. One of the main culprits of diet-related hair loss is a deficiency in certain vitamins and nutrients. Specifically, a lack of vitamin D, iron, and protein can lead to hair thinning and loss. Vitamin D is important for hair growth, as well as overall bone health and immunity. Iron is necessary for the production of hemoglobin, which carries oxygen to the body’s cells, including those in the scalp. Lastly, protein is essential for the building blocks of hair, as it is made up primarily of a protein called keratin. So, what can you do if you suspect that your diet is contributing to hair loss? First and foremost, speak with your healthcare provider about any concerns you may have. They can perform blood work to check for deficiencies and provide guidance on appropriate supplementation if necessary. In addition to consulting with a healthcare provider, incorporating certain foods into your diet can also help promote hair growth and decrease hair loss. Foods rich in vitamin D include fatty fish (such as salmon and tuna) and fortified cereals and dairy products. Iron can be found in red meat, poultry, seafood, beans, and leafy green vegetables. Lastly, protein can be found in meat, poultry, fish, beans, nuts, and seeds. It’s also important to maintain a balanced diet overall and avoid crash dieting or severe caloric restriction. Sudden weight loss or a lack of proper nutrition can lead to hair loss as well. In terms of hair care, it’s important to avoid harsh chemicals and heat styling tools, as they can damage the hair and contribute to breakage and loss. Instead, opt for gentle shampoos and conditioners, and allow your hair to air dry as much as possible. In summary, while there are many factors that contribute to hair loss, diet is definitely one to consider. By ensuring adequate intake of important vitamins and nutrients, as well as maintaining a balanced diet overall, you can promote healthy hair growth and minimize hair loss. And as always, consult with your healthcare provider before making any significant dietary changes or starting new supplements.
